Quoted from Alfred Today:

The Alfred University Football Team's game this Saturday, Oct. 27, at 1 p.m., at Hobart will be shown live on the internet.

The live video Webcast is sponsored by the Eastern College Athletic Conference (ECAC) and can be accessed by going to http://www.ecac.tv/. The cost of accessing the Webcast is $7.95.

The AU football team has an overall record of 7-0 - the team's best since the 1981 Saxons finished 10-0 in the regular season en route to the school's first and only appearance in the NCAA Division III championship tournament - and is in first place in the Empire 8 with a 4-0 conference mark.

Alfred is ranked 11th and 13th, respectively, in this week's D3football.com and American Football Coaches Association national polls of Division III teams. The Saxons are also ranked second in the latest ECAC Lambert Poll for Division III, behind Washington & Jefferson College (Washington, PA).

Established in 1936 as the Lambert Trophy to recognize supremacy in Eastern college football, the award has since grown to recognize the best team in the East in the Bowl Subdivision. The Lambert Cup will be awarded to teams in the other three divisions. AU last won the Lambert Cup in 1971, when the Saxons finished with an 8-0 record.

The Saxons wrap up their season with three road games: this Saturday at Hobart, Nov. 3 at Ithaca, and Nov. 10 at St. John Fisher. Kickoff for all three games is at 1 p.m. Regardless of what Alfred does in its next two games, if St. John Fisher defeats Utica this weekend, the Nov. 10 AU and Fisher will be for the Empire 8 Conference championship and an automatic bid to the NCAA playoffs.
